Bald Eagle rallies back on fifth inning to overtake Penns Valley
After trailing 4-1 going into the top of the fifth against a tough Penns Valley team, the Bald Eagle softball team rallied back in a big way, taking the lead away with an 9-run inning.
In the end, the Eagles would hold onto the lead en route to the 10-5 victory over Penns Valley Thursday in Mountain League action.
Maddie Peters picked up the win for Bald Eagle with four strikeouts while Avery Dinges picked up the tough loss.
The Lady Eagles finished with 12 hits while the Rams tallied 11.
